Abstract :
Generalizing the classical definition of a weak Linfin-solution definitions of delta- and delta´-shocks for systems of conservation laws were introduced and the Cauchy problems admitting such singular solutions were solved. In this paper we discuss and substantiate the validity and naturalness of the above-mentioned definitions. As these definitions differ from the classical definition of a weak Linfin-solution, this problem is important
